Wheelchair-Accessible Dimensions Plus Ramp Specs

The ADA-Compliant Portable Toilet measures 62 by 62 inches across the base. This wheelchair-accessible portable toilet sits at a sub-half-inch threshold for a wheelchair to roll straight in. Builders accommodate the 60-inch turning radius inside the ribbed HDPE panels. We handle the event portable restroom rental with ADA pairing for large crowds.

Grab bars are mounted 33–36 inches high with a reinforced hinge; we deliver same-day when you order an ADA compliant restroom for your site.

When ADA Units Are Required by Code

Federal law and local codes across Midland require accessible restroom options for public-funded work. Proper construction site ADA compliant restroom planning starting at the bid stage meets ADA Standard 213.

Public Events

Festivals and ticketed public gatherings must offer accessible facilities under ANSI A117.1.

Public-Funded Jobsites

Federally funded projects must provide accessible temporary sanitation.

ADA Title III

Places of public accommodation require barrier-free restroom access.

Accessibility Ratios

Five percent of stalls on site must be ADA-compliant, with a minimum of one.

+ How much wider is an ADA unit than a standard porta potty?

An ADA unit measures 62 by 62 inches at the base for a 60-inch interior turning radius, while a standard porta potty is 44 by 48 inches with a 32-inch minimum door width and waste tank.

+ How many ADA units does my event or jobsite need?

The working rule is one accessible unit per every five percent of total stalls, with a minimum of one. Dispatch runs those numbers and the required holding tank capacity when you order.
